Target Corporation is an S corporation with one shareholder, Rhonda White. Acquiring Corporation wants to buy the stock of Target. Target has valuable leases in place that require that the entity stay in existence, and so Acquiring will buy the stock. Acquiring proposes to pay $11,800,000 for the stock of Target. Rhonda has agreed to this offer. Rhonda’s basis in her Target stock is $5,340,000. Rhonda’s tax advisor has told her that the stock sale will produce a long-term capital gain of $6,460,000 that will be taxed at a 20% rate. Rhonda pays a 37% tax on ordinary income. Acquiring now has approached Rhonda and told her that it wants Rhonda to agree to make a Section 338(h)(10) election. This will treat the stock purchase/sale as a deemed purchase/sale of the assets of Target. The tax basis of Target assets is $5,340,000 (the same as Rhonda’s stock basis). However, the Target assets consist of the following: Asset Fair Value Tax Basis Character of Gain if Sold Cash 240,000 240,000 Receivables 860,000 600,000 Ordinary Inventory 2,300,000 1,400,000 Ordinary Equipment 2,700,000 800,000 Ordinary Land 700,000 300,000 Capital Building 4,300,000 2,200,000 Capital Goodwill Capital.
